Objectives

Responsible for all team members’ safety and well-being, overall development and supervision of Team Leaders and Team Members, health and safety, quality, customer cost, productivity, and ergonomic issues through using the company policies and procedures and the “Our Client” Employee’s Charter as a guideline.

  3. Ensure daily pre-shift inspections are completed, conduct unplanned inspection audits on a weekly basis and planned inspection audits once a month
  4. Routinely make visual inspections of emergency evacuations routes correcting any safety concerns immediately
  5. Within 24 hours of an accident/incident complete accident investigations identifying root cause and corrective action
  6. Ensure weekly safety talks in pre-shift meetings are being conducted with team members signing safety training roster
  7. Schedule, supervise, coordinate, and direct the activities of team members to ensure that production levels and quality standards are met
